Make sure you have your `/dev/net/tun` device setup on your host with one of the following commands, depending on your OS: ```bash insmod /lib/modules/tun.ko ``` Or ```bash modprobe tun ``` 1. Launch the container with: ```bash docker run -d --name=pia -v ./auth.conf:/auth.conf:ro \ --cap-add=NET_ADMIN --device=/dev/net/tun --network=pianet \ -e REGION="CA Montreal" -e PROTOCOL=udp -e ENCRYPTION=strong \ -e USER=js89ds7 -e PASSWORD=8fd9s239G \ qmcgaw/private-internet-access ``` or use [docker-compose.yml](https://github.com/qdm12/private-internet-access-docker/blob/master/docker-compose.yml) with: ```bash docker-compose up -d ``` Note that you can change all the [environment variables](#environment-variables) 1. Wait about 5 seconds for it to connect to the PIA server. You can check with: ```bash docker logs -f pia ``` 1. Follow the [**Testing section**](#testing) ## Testing You can simply use the Docker healthcheck. The container will mark itself as **unhealthy** if the public IP address is the same as your initial public IP address. Otherwise you can follow these instructions: 1. Check your host IP address with: ```bash wget -qO- https://ipinfo.io/ip ``` 1. Run the same command in a Docker container using your *pia* container as network with: ```bash docker run --rm --network=container:pia alpine:3.8 wget -qO- https://ipinfo.io/ip ``` If the displayed IP address appears and is different that your host IP address, the PIA client works ! ## Environment variables | Environment variable | Default | Description | | --- | --- | --- | | `REGION` | `CA Montreal` | One of the [PIA regions](https://www.privateinternetaccess.com/pages/network/) | | `PROTOCOL` | `udp` | `tcp` or `udp` | | `ENCRYPTION` | `strong` | `normal` or `strong` | | `BLOCK_MALICIOUS` | `off` | `on` or `off` | | `USER` | `` | Your PIA username | | `PASSWORD` | `` | Your PIA password | | `EXTRA_SUBNETS` | `` | Comma separated subnets allowed in the container firewall | `EXTRA_SUBNETS` can be in example: `192.168.1.0/24,192.168.10.121,10.0.0.5/28` ## Connect other containers to it Connect other Docker containers to the PIA VPN connection by adding `--network=container:pia` when launching them. ## For the paranoids - You can review the code which essential consits in the [Dockerfile](https://github.com/qdm12/private-internet-access-docker/blob/master/Dockerfile) and [entrypoint.sh](https://github.com/qdm12/private-internet-access-docker/blob/master/entrypoint.sh) - Build the images yourself: ```bash docker build -t qmcgaw/private-internet-access https://github.com/qdm12/private-internet-access-docker.git ``` - The download and unziping of PIA openvpn files is done at build for the ones not able to download the zip files - Checksums for PIA openvpn zip files are not used as these files change often (but HTTPS is used) - Use `-e ENCRYPTION=strong -e BLOCK_MALICIOUS=on` ## TODOs - [ ] Malicious IPs and hostnames with wget at launch+checksums - [ ] Su Exec (fork and addition) - [ ] SOCKS proxy/Hiproxy/VPN server for other devices to use the container ## License This repository is under an [MIT license](https://github.com/qdm12/private-internet-access-docker/master/license)
